Ola Hawatmeh has a robust background in both entrepreneurial ventures and public service. He founded Mom Me Makeover and Makeover for a Cause in 2004, establishing a legacy of community empowerment and philanthropy. Hawatmeh has dedicated his career to addressing policy-related issues, most recently as a Senior Policy Advisor in Washington, D.C. His professional expertise spans across risk management in high-finance and public sector policy-making, showcasing a versatile skill set.
Ola Hawatmeh combines a business-oriented approach with a strong focus on community empowerment, advocating for tax cuts and deregulation while prioritizing local infrastructure projects. His support for border security and trade protection measures reveals an unexpected alignment with economic nationalism. Hawatmeh's dedication to clean water initiatives and transparency in federal funding highlights a localized, results-driven strategy.
